Active Site Engineering in CoP@NC/Graphene Heterostructures Enabling Enhanced Hydrogen Evolution

Abstract: As the core of an electrocatalyst, the active site is critical to determine its catalytic performance in the hydrogen evolution reaction (HER). In this work, porous N-doped carbon-encapsulated CoP nanoparticles on both sides of graphene (CoP@ NC/GR) are derived from a bimetallic metal−organic framework (MOF)@graphene oxide composite. Through active site engineering by tailoring the environment around CoP and engineering the structure, the HER activity of CoP@NC/GR heterostructures is significantly enhanced. Bo… Show more

“…The overpotential (105 mV) and Tafel slope (47.5 mV dec –1 ) of CoP@NC/GR were smaller than those of CoP and CoP@NC. Finally, the electrocatalytic activity for CoP@NC/GR remained largely unchanged after 20 h of continuous HER testing in 0.5 M H 2 SO 4 at 20 mA cm –2 , meaning that the integration of GO strongly enhances the stability of CoP@NC/GR . On top of the pyrolysis, doping with S and N elements was used to replace P elements in a further discussion of the electrochemical properties.…”
